About Billy Bean
Billy Bean is a former professional baseball player. In July 2014, he was named MLB’s first Ambassador for Inclusion. In January 2016 he became MLB’s Vice President, Social Responsibility & Inclusion, and is currently Vice President and Special Assistant to the Commissioner. Bean works with MLB’s 30 clubs to advance equality for all players, coaches, managers, umpires, employees, and stakeholders throughout baseball to ensure an equitable, inclusive, and supportive workplace for everyone.
